Paver Driveway Construction in Saint George, UT
Paver driveway construction involves designing and installing durable, attractive driveways using interlocking paving stones. These projects typically include preparing the existing surface, laying a stable base, and carefully placing the pavers to create a smooth, long-lasting surface. Homeowners often choose paver driveways for their visual appeal, customization options, and ability to withstand heavy use and varying weather conditions.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ider factors such as the size of the driveway, the type of pavers desired, and any specific design preferences or patterns they want to incorporate.
Understanding the scope of paver driveway construction also involves knowing about site preparation requirements, drainage considerations, and the overall maintenance needed to keep the surface in good condition. Property owners usually want to clarify the materials used, the expected lifespan of the installation, and any necessary preparatory work to ensure proper installation. Clear communication about these aspects can help in planning a project that meets aesthetic goals and functional needs for years to come.

Paver Driveway Construction Questions
What types of pavers are suitable for driveways? Concrete, brick, and natural stone pavers are common choices for durable and attractive driveway surfaces.
How thick should pavers be for a driveway? Pavers typically need to be at least 2.5 to 3 inches thick to withstand vehicle traffic effectively.
What is the typical process for constructing a paver driveway? The process usually involves preparing the base, laying a gravel or sand bed, and then carefully installing and jointing the pavers.
Are paver driveways a good option for uneven terrain? Yes, pavers can be installed on uneven ground by adjusting the base and using proper leveling techniques for stability.
